The HI-88703-02 turbidity bench top meter is specially designed for water quality measurements, providing reliable and accurate readings on low turbidity ranges.

This instrument has an EPA compliance reading mode which rounds the reading to meet EPA reporting requirements. Depending on the measured sample and needed accuracy, normal, continuous or signal averaging measurement can be selected.

A two, three, four or five-point calibration can be performed. When user prepared standards are used, calibration points can be modified. The HI-88703-02 features complete GLP (Good Laboratory Practice) functions that allow traceability of the calibration conditions. The last calibration points, time and date can be checked. Up to 200 measurements can be stored in internal memory. Data can be transferred to a PC via optional HI-920013 USB cable and HI-92000 Windows® compatible software.

The HI-88703-02 meets and exceeds the requirements of USEPA and Standard Methods.

Additional Specifications
Range SelectionAutomatic
Accuracy±2% of reading plus 0.02 NTU (0.15 Nephelos; 0.01 EBC);
±5% of reading above 1000 NTU (6700 Nephelos; 245 EBC)
Repeatability±1% of reading or 0.02 NTU (0.15 Nephelos; 0.01 EBC) whichever is greater
Stray LightLess than 0.02 NTU (0.15 Nephelos; 0.01 EBC)
Light Detectorsilicon photocell
Light source/LifeTungsten Filament Lamp/greater than 100,000 readings
Display40 x 70 mm graphic LCD (64 x 128 pixels) with backlight
Methodnephelometric method (90°) or ratio nephelometric method (90° & 180°), adaptation of the USEPA method 180.1 and standard method 2130 B
Measuring ModeNormal, average, continuous
Turbidity StandardsLess than 0.1, 15, 100, 750 and 2000 NTU
Calibrationtwo, three, four or five-point calibration
